The video explores the extravagant funeral of Alexander the Great and contrasts it with modern funeral costs, which have risen significantly over the years. It highlights the financial challenges faced by grieving families, especially when no will is in place, using a case study of Martha's funeral. The video suggests ways to reduce funeral costs, such as having a will, considering cremation, or donating the body to science. It concludes with a call to action for viewers to plan their funeral arrangements to avoid burdening loved ones.
